引言
随着互联网技术的飞速发展,前端设计在用户体验中的重要性日益凸显。一个好的前端设计不仅能够提升用户的视觉体验,还能提高用户的使用效率,从而增强用户对产品的忠诚度。本文将深入探讨前端设计的关键要素,以及如何打造既美观又实用的用户体验。
一、了解用户需求
1. 用户研究
在进行前端设计之前,首先要了解目标用户群体的需求。这可以通过用户调研、问卷调查、用户访谈等方式实现。通过研究用户的行为习惯、喜好和痛点,可以为设计提供有力的数据支持。
2. 需求分析
在收集到用户需求后,需要对需求进行分析,确定设计的核心功能和目标。这有助于确保设计方向与用户需求保持一致。
二、设计原则
1. 用户体验优先
在设计中,始终将用户体验放在首位。这意味着要关注用户在使用过程中的舒适度、易用性和效率。
2. 简洁明了
简洁的设计更容易让用户理解和使用。避免过多的装饰和复杂的布局,使界面保持清晰、直观。
3. 一致性
保持设计风格的一致性,包括颜色、字体、图标等元素,有助于提升用户体验。
4. 适应性
设计应具备良好的适应性,能够在不同的设备上保持良好的视觉效果和操作体验。
三、前端技术
1. HTML
HTML是构建网页的基本语言,负责网页的结构和内容。在设计过程中,应遵循语义化标签的规范,提高网页的可读性和可维护性。
2. CSS
CSS用于美化网页,包括颜色、字体、布局等。在设计时,应注重响应式布局,确保网页在不同设备上都能良好展示。
3. JavaScript
JavaScript用于实现网页的动态效果和交互功能。在设计过程中,应关注代码的可读性和可维护性,避免过度依赖JavaScript。
四、案例分析
以下是一些优秀的前端设计案例,供参考:
1. Airbnb
Airbnb的前端设计简洁明了,色彩搭配和谐,且具有良好的适应性。在用户浏览房源时,能够快速找到所需信息。
2. Slack
Slack的前端设计注重用户体验,界面友好,操作便捷。通过丰富的表情和动画效果,提升了用户的互动体验。
3. Netflix
Netflix的前端设计注重视觉冲击力,色彩运用恰到好处。在推荐页面上,通过算法为用户推荐感兴趣的内容。
五、总结
打造既美观又实用的用户体验,需要前端设计师深入了解用户需求,遵循设计原则,运用前端技术,并结合优秀案例进行实践。通过不断优化和改进,相信我们能够为用户提供更加优质的前端设计。
